...
[www/www.git] / cscweb.xsl
index dc0b69b..97d0a8f 100755 (executable)
@@ -31,6 +31,7 @@
 </xsl:template>
 
 <xsl:template match="section">
 </xsl:template>
 
 <xsl:template match="section">
+ <xsl:if test="@id != ''"><a id="{@id}" /></xsl:if>
  <h2><xsl:value-of select="@title"/></h2>
  <xsl:apply-templates />
 </xsl:template>
  <h2><xsl:value-of select="@title"/></h2>
  <xsl:apply-templates />
 </xsl:template>
   </table>
 </xsl:template>
 
   </table>
 </xsl:template>
 
+<xsl:template match="mediafile" >
+       ,<a href="/media/files/{@file}"><xsl:value-of select="@type" />(<xsl:value-of select="@size" />)</a>
+</xsl:template>
+
+<xsl:template match="mediaitem">
+       <li><xsl:value-of select="@title" /> - <xsl:apply-templates select="mediafile" /></li>
+</xsl:template>
+
 <xsl:template match="menuitem">
     <td bgcolor="#eeeeee" class="button">
      <a href="{@href}"><img border="0" src="/buttons/{@icon}.png"
 <xsl:template match="menuitem">
     <td bgcolor="#eeeeee" class="button">
      <a href="{@href}"><img border="0" src="/buttons/{@icon}.png"
  <tr>
   <td class="newsitem" bgcolor="white" colspan="2">
    <a href="news/">Older news items</a> are available. Make sure you
  <tr>
   <td class="newsitem" bgcolor="white" colspan="2">
    <a href="news/">Older news items</a> are available. Make sure you
-   check out the <a href="nntp://uw.csc">uw.csc</a> newsgroup and our
+   check out the <a href="/newsgroup/thread.php?group=uw.csc">uw.csc</a> newsgroup and our
    announcement boards on the second and third floor of MC for more
    updates.
   </td>
    announcement boards on the second and third floor of MC for more
    updates.
   </td>